Alert! Oklahoma and Texas Under Storm Siege โ€“ Find Out Whatโ€™s Coming Before 7 PM!

Residentsย throughoutย portionsย of Oklahoma and Texas areย inย aย heightened state ofย alert as a severe thunderstorm watch has beenย postedย until 7 PM. Meteorologists haveย cautionedย thatย windย and hail areย likelyย toย accompanyย theย impendingย storm system, whichย mayย bring rapidlyย worseningย conditions and hazardousย effectsย forย motoristsย and…